It was at that moment that the bell downstairs resounded throughout the mansion. Mortimer had been staring thoughtfully at the wall, captivated by his perspicacious musings, and now, after being quite rudely interrupted he snapped to attention. Without hesitation, he lumbered toward the windows on the opposite end of his room, careful to step around the mounds of treasure that covered the wooden floors of his study. He launched his frame like a beached whale over his four-poster bed, and once he had righted himself again, he swiftly pulled the glass panes open and peered down. He had selected his room for this particular purpose.
